Job DetailsJob Location: Tuttle Care Center - Tuttle, OK 73089Position Type: Full TimeJob Shift: DayThe Housekeeping Aide is responsible for maintaining a clean, sanitary, and safe environment for residents, staff, and visitors within the facility. This role supports infection prevention efforts and helps ensure compliance with health and safety standards in long-term care. Key Responsibilities Clean and sanitize resident rooms, bathrooms, hallways, offices, and common areas. Sweep, mop, vacuum, dust, and disinfect surfaces throughout the facility. Empty trash and replace liners in resident rooms and common areas. Clean and disinfect high-touch surfaces such as door handles, handrails, and equipment. Follow infection control procedures and proper use of cleaning chemicals. Replenish supplies such as paper towels, soap, and toilet paper. Respond to housekeeping requests from nursing staff and residents. Follow facility safety policies and proper waste disposal procedures. Assist with terminal cleaning of rooms after resident discharge or transfer. Maintain housekeeping carts and equipment in a clean and organized condition. Qualifications High school diploma or GED preferred. Previous housekeeping experience in healthcare, long-term care, or hospitality preferred. Knowledge of cleaning chemicals and infection control practices. Ability to follow safety procedures and facility policies.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
